📄 uneworder.pas
字号:
unit Uneworder;
interface
uses
Windows, Messages, SysUtils, Classes, Graphics, Controls, Forms, Dialogs,
ComCtrls, StdCtrls, Buttons, ToolWin, DBCtrls, Grids, DBGridEh, Mask,
ExtCtrls, Impstringgrid;
type
TFrmneworder = class(TForm)
ToolBar1: TToolBar;
BitBtn10: TBitBtn;
BitBtn1: TBitBtn;
ToolButton4: TToolButton;
ToolButton3: TToolButton;
BitBtn4: TBitBtn;
BitBtn3: TBitBtn;
BitBtn6: TBitBtn;
BitBtn7: TBitBtn;
BitBtn9: TBitBtn;
BitBtn2: TBitBtn;
BitBtn8: TBitBtn;
ToolButton1: TToolButton;
BtnFind: TBitBtn;
ToolButton2: TToolButton;
BitBtn11: TBitBtn;
BitBtn5: TBitBtn;
Panel1: TPanel;
Label25: TLabel;
Label27: TLabel;
DBEdit1_1: TDBEdit;
DBEdit1_2: TDBEdit;
DTP1: TDateTimePicker;
DBLookupComboBox1: TDBLookupComboBox;
Panel2: TPanel;
DBGridEh1: TDBGridEh;
Panel3: TPanel;
BitBtn12: TBitBtn;
Label26: TLabel;
Label1: TLabel;
DBEdit1: TDBEdit;
BitBtn13: TBitBtn;
BitBtn14: TBitBtn;
Splitter1: TSplitter;
Panel4: TPanel;
Panel5: TPanel;
DBImage2: TDBImage;
Label19: TLabel;
DBImage1: TDBImage;
Label22: TLabel;
ImpStringgrid1: TImpStringgrid;
procedure FormShow(Sender: TObject);
procedure FormClose(Sender: TObject; var Action: TCloseAction);
procedure BitBtn5Click(Sender: TObject);
procedure BitBtn12Click(Sender: TObject);
procedure FormCreate(Sender: TObject);
private
{ Private declarations }
public
{ Public declarations }
end;
var
Frmneworder: TFrmneworder;
implementation
uses Umain, Uorder, USize;
{$R *.DFM}
procedure TFrmneworder.FormShow(Sender: TObject);
begin
frmmain.Outlook1.Visible:=False;
frmmain.Panel1.Visible:=true;
frmmain.Panel2.Visible:=false;
end;
procedure TFrmneworder.FormClose(Sender: TObject;
var Action: TCloseAction);
begin
Frmmain.Outlook1.Visible :=true;
frmmain.Panel1.Visible:=true;
Frmmain.Panel2.Visible:=True;
frmmain.LTitle.Caption:='';
Frmneworder:=nil;
action:=cafree;
end;
procedure TFrmneworder.BitBtn5Click(Sender: TObject);
begin
Close;
end;
procedure TFrmneworder.BitBtn12Click(Sender: TObject);
var i,j,z:integer;
begin
frmsize:=TFrmsize.create(nil);
Frmsize.showmodal;
if Frmsize.ModalResult =mrok then
begin
with Frmsize do
begin
for i:=0 to Lstset.Items.Count-1 do
begin
if LstSet.Checked[i]=true then
begin
j:=j+1;
end;
end
end;
end;
Frmsize.free;
end;
procedure TFrmneworder.FormCreate(Sender: TObject);
var
i,j:integer;
begin
ImpStringgrid1.Columns.Grid.ColWidths[0]:=10;
for i:=0 to ImpStringgrid1.Columns.Grid.RowCount-1 do
begin
ImpStringgrid1.Columns.Grid.RowHeights[i]:=19;
end;
for i:=0 to ImpStringgrid1.Columns.Grid.colCount-1 do
begin
ImpStringgrid1.Columns.Items[i].Title.Alignment :=taCenter;
ImpStringgrid1.Columns.Items[I].Alignment :=taCenter;
end;
end;
end.
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-